
March Break… in French!
Join our Francophone program for an exciting week at the Alliance Française with our various partners. Francophone and Francophile children are welcome. All activities are conducted in French.

Schedules and programs
9am - 12pm: language workshops and games in French
12pm - 1pm : lunch break
1:00 - 4:00 pm: camp-specific activity
A daycare service (optional) is offered from 8am to 9am and from 4pm to 6pm.
Age
We welcome children ages 5 to 11. Please see the camp program for the age range for each camp.
Price
Please see the camp program for prices for each camp.


Discover the world of coding!
In this beginner coding camp, you will develop your computational thinking in a fun and playful way, all while creating an interactive game with Scratch. You will also have the chance to create your own website!
- Required material:
A laptop or Chromebook (tablets will not be sufficient)
A mouse
An updated Internet browser (ideally Chrome, but Firefox or Safari could work too)
Our partner for this camp: This camp will be led by Jonathan, a Francophone youth that is passionate about technology. Jonathan has vast experience in teaching and conducting workshops about coding and programming. He aims to share his enthusiasm and passion with more youth.
Age: 8- 10 years old


MUSICAL
Ekin Agency Arts will offer a musical camp based on Art History. From Picasso to Frida Kahlo, get on board to travel back in time, explore different artistic movements and discover passionate characters who described the world of their time through their art.
On the last day of camp, invite your loved ones for a performance at the Alliance Française theatre!
- Activities:
Singing and dancing, DIY, painting, drawing
Drama, collective creation
Exhibition visit ( ticket price included)
Our partner for this camp: Ekin is an artistic agency that includes a collective of artists in the performing arts (theatre, dance, literature writing, music, singing…).
Age: 5-8 years old


Shoot your first movie
Explore the art of creating a video!
In the “Shoot Your First Movie” camp, you will discover simple tips and tricks on producing a short film.
- Join us and learn the 4 basic steps in producing a short film:
Write a story (scenario)
Set the scene (make a movie set or costume)
Direct (mini camera provided)
Edit (in a team, editing software provided)
Our partner for this camp: Le Labo is a centre of Francophone artists in Toronto that specialize in digital and media arts. Le Labo is known for their high-quality, diverse, and multidisciplinary programs, as well as their passion for the next generation of children.
Age: 8-11 years old
